Here is my beautiful 2001 Alfa Romeo GTV6. I've owned this for the last 2 1/2 years and it's been my daily driver for this time over which it's covered around 14000 happy miles. It was bought as a keeper, however we've acquired a dog since then and I'm reliably informed a GTV isn't a great dog carrier. Who knew eh? Since buying it we've toured western Scotland and Skye, and multiple trips to North Yorkshire and Norfolk. It's a fantastic and comfortable grand tourer, as long as you pack well, although the back seats are good for coats and the odd bag of it's just 2 of you. There's a history file at least an inch thick, along with all 4 keys (including the brown one and the valet). Both original meta alarm fobs work perfectly. The car had a new gearbox in 2011 when it received a Q2 diff as well, all documented in the extensive history file. It benefits from a full stainless system from the Cat back. 17 inch Teledials with Continental Sport Contacts all round, oldest 2022. New rear shocks/springs in my ownership along with front and rear disks, clutch and gearbox oil change. It's also had an Alfaholics short throw gear lever adapter fitted. Serviced every year with me. I've been fettling it along the way too, the windows now both drop properly on door opening (they didn't when I bought it, a right pain!). Also the centre cubby box now has padding on top, so much nicer for your elbow (no idea why Alfa didn't offer this), I have a non padded one I'll throw in if you want it. Sony FM/DAB/CD stereo fitted with new speakers throughout, Alpine fronts and JBL rears. Fully working electric aerial. Wooden steering wheel from an Alfa 166 fitted, really lifts the interior. MOT til 23/2/26 The paint is not great, numerous stone chips on the nose and a scuff on the offside bonnet (from a passing car, I keep it on the road as I don't have off-road parking). Really it needs a respray, that was the original plan, but it polishes up well as seem in the photos. I've loved dailying this quad cam 3.0l V6 for the last couple of years (never used around town only on runs where the engine warms up to temperature, I live in a small market town in Lincolnshire where everywhere is walkable, including work) but it's time to say goodbye.
